About PNB Ltd-
PNB are focused on continuing our investment in our technology platforms and systems. Our direct banking platforms enable us to connect with our customers through alternate channels by improving customer retention and supporting the increase in volume of customer transactions.
Our principal business operations are broadly categorized into four segments: our corporate/wholesale banking segment comprises commercial banking products and transactional services.
Which are provided to our corporate and institutional clients; retail banking comprises financial products provided to our retail customers; treasury operations comprising primarily of statutory reserves management, liquidity management and other such services and other banking operations comprising primarily of rural business and agri-business.
- India’s first Swadeshi Bank, founded in Lahore on May 19, 1894 by Shri Lala Lajpat Rai and commenced its operations on April 12, 1895.
- Nationalized by GOI in July 1969 along with 13 other banks, PNB is now the 2nd largest PSU Bank in India with a Business of INR 24.36 lakh Crores (Trillion).
- 73.15% stake is owned by the Government of India.
- PNB successfully raised INR 3,788 crore through a Qualified Institutional Placement (QIP) in December 2020, followed by an additional INR 1,800 crore raised in May 2021.
- PNB has wide presence across India with total 54,860 touch points comprising of 10,150 domestic branches, 12,080 ATMs and 32,630 BCs.
- PNB has 2nd Largest Domestic Branch Network.
- Undergone Digital Transformation in 2022 and HR Transformation Project in 2023.
- Achieving digital acceleration through PNB One App where the bank offers both digital and value-added services.
- Dedicated team of ~1 lakh employees proudly serves over 19 crore valued customers.
